TECHNICAL DIVE TRAINING

Bernie Chowdhury’s TDI Technical Diving Courses

As of:  March 24, 2009

Course Costs include:  classroom and in-water instruction, and certification card upon successful completion of all course requirements.

Additional Costs include:  Required TDI student manual(s) for course(s).  Students must pay their own entrance fees to quarries/springs/dive sites and dive charters, their breathing gases, gasoline/transportation to/from dive site, tolls, hotel, food, etc.  All students undergoing in-water training on a given day will share in paying for Bernie’s out-of-pocket expenses, including: entrance fees to quarries/springs/dive sites and dive charters, breathing gases, gasoline/transportation to/from dive site, tolls, hotel, food, etc.

NOTE 1: Bernie frequently gets an instructor courtesy admission to quarries/springs/dive sites (e.g. Dutch Springs quarry) and also on some dive boats.  Students may also car pool.  The per-student fee for Bernie’s out-of-pocket expenses for Dutch Springs Quarry dives (which cover mandatory safety drills for all TDI courses) is $30 per student, per day.  Dive boat costs and breathing gases are in addition to this.

NOTE 2:  Bernie’s Intro to Technical Diving and Intermediate Technical Diver courses each require a minimum of two (2) days at Dutch Springs.

Course - per  Student   (prices are in U.S. Dollars)

[Intro to Tech (lecture only) - 25 – this is applied to the Intro to Tech course]

Intro to Tech - 250
(Lecture plus four (4) no-decompression training dives over two days to a max of 75 feet.  Cost includes use of the following tech gear: guideline reel, liftbag, jonline.  The final dive may include the use of my pony bottles and/or use of my double tanks, wings and backplate/harness.)

Nitrox - 139
(Less than 40% oxygen – classroom only.)

Intermediate Tech - 350
(Two days diving at Dutch Springs with tech diving configuration, either wings BC, single w/pony and stage bottle, or wings BC with double tanks and then stage bottle.  Cost includes use of my tech gear.)

Advanced Nitrox - 395
(Up to 100% oxygen)

Deco Procedures - 450
(Training dives to 150 feet max.)

[Combined Course – Advanced Nitrox & Deco Procedures = $800 - two cert cards issued.]

Extended Range - 1,000
(Training dives using air to 180 feet, max)

Advanced Wreck - 1,000
(Training dives to 180 feet max.  This course requires a min of six (6) wreck penetration dives.)

Basic Trimix - 1,000
(Training dives to a max of 200 Feet.  At least two (2) dives have to be deeper than 130 feet. Bottom mix to contain not less than 18% oxygen.)

Advanced Trimix - 1,250
(Training dives to a maximum of 330 feet.  At least two (2) dives should be deeper than 180 feet.)

Cavern and Cave diving classes can be arranged, and are co-taught by Bernie with another instructor.  Training dives can be conducted in Florida or in Mexico.  If another location is desired, that can be arranged.
